The software is celebrated for its range, offering everything from classic clean tones to aggressive high-gain distortion.

Iconic Recreations: Many presets are "Song Presets" designed to faithfully recreate the signature sounds of famous guitarists for their classic tracks.

High-Gain Depth: Presets like "Metal Crunch" (also known as Double Wreck) are noted for delivering a booming low end and sharp top end, perfect for modern metal.

Customization: Users can edit existing presets or build from scratch, saving up to eight custom sounds to "User Presets" for quick recall. Ease of Use & Integration

Visual Editing: Users find the Tone Room app (available on PC, Mac, and iOS) much more intuitive than adjusting physical knobs for complex settings.

Librarian Functions: It serves as a powerful librarian, allowing you to back up settings and organize large batches of setups, which is particularly useful for gigging or recording.

The Digital Backbone of Modern Vox Amps: Tone Room Presets VOX Tone Room is a comprehensive editor and librarian software designed for Vox Amps like the VT20X/40X/100X, VX II, Adio Air, and Cambridge50. Its primary function is to serve as a digital bridge, allowing guitarists to go beyond the physical knobs on their amplifiers to unlock deeper customization through presets. The Role of Presets in Tone Crafting

A preset in Tone Room is a saved digital "snapshot" that includes a specific amp model combined with a series of effects—such as overdrive, reverb, delay, and modulation.

Deep Editing: While physical amps have limited knobs, Tone Room provides a graphical interface where users can fine-tune hidden parameters like gain, treble, middle, and bass with more precision.

Educational Value: For beginners, factory presets serve as a reference point for learning how certain effects (like pre-delay in reverb) interact with specific amp models. Managing and Organizing Your Sound

The software acts as a "librarian," helping you organize and backup your favorite settings so they aren't lost when you turn off the amplifier.
